Результаты проведения натурных измерений и обработки измерительной информации о яркостях воздушных целей на фоне облачного неба в диапазонах длин волн 2,6-4,2 и 8-13 мкм

Abstract

Необходимость исследований излучений воздушных целей на фоне облачного неба в инфракрасном диапазоне волн вызвана тем, что при проектировании оптико-электронных обнаружителей требуется оценить ожидаемую дальность действия при обнаружении воздушных целей различных типов в случаях различных метеорологических ситуаций, т.е. в условиях воздействия естественных помех, создаваемых облачной атмосферой. В работе исследован один из подходов исследования характера излучения типовой воздушной цели.
